我有一个使用SQLite数据库的应用程序。我在应用程序启动时创建了数据库,调用了RSSDatabase的构造函数,它工作正常。单击按钮后,我从RSS提要获取数据并将数据插入AsyncTask,但是当我调用db.insert("posts","",values)时会导致错误,这是logcat的错误消息:02-0421:43:22.05019154-19357/com.example.aolreaderE/SQLiteLog﹕(1802)os_unix.c:30026:(2)stat(/data/data/com.example.aolreader/databases/rss_db)-02
因此,在极少数情况下,我会看到“尝试写入只读数据库”消息,但我无法弄清楚问题出在哪里。我将从我的logcat中的堆栈跟踪开始......正如您从时间戳中看到的那样,我在尝试写入之前仅检查db.isReadOnly()1ms。(isOpen=true,readOnly=false)01-2913:47:49.115:D/AWT(11055):#479.Gotwritabledatabase(230537815):isOpen:(true)isReadOnly:(false)inTransaction:(false)01-2913:47:49.116:D/AWT(11055):#479.i
我正在尝试创建一个简单的项目来探索EntityFramework6codefirst与sqlitedbprovider的工作原理,但是当我编译我的应用程序时,我收到错误:"TheEntityFrameworkprovidertype'System.Data.SQLite.SQLiteProviderServices,System.Data.SQLite.Linq,Version=1.0.91.0,Culture=neutral,PublicKeyToken=db937bc2d44ff139'registeredintheapplicationconfigfilefortheADO.NE
使用来自NuGet的最新版本的EF6和SQLite。在Stackoverflow上发表了一些有用的帖子之后,我终于让app.config文件可以工作了。现在的问题是虽然创建了数据库,但没有创建表。我的应用程序配置:我的简单测试程序:classProgram{staticvoidMain(string[]args){using(vardb=newMyDBContext()){db.Notes.Add(newNote{Text="Hello,world"});db.Notes.Add(newNote{Text="Asecondnote"});db.Notes.Add(newNote{Tex
我刚刚注册了这个问题。这是关于是否可以使用VSCode在Docker容器中远程调试python代码。我在这里有一个完全配置的Docker容器。我得到了一些帮助,而且我对docker还是很陌生。在其中运行Odoov10。但是我无法在VSCode中进行远程调试。我试过this解释,但我真的不明白。甚至可能吗?如果是,我怎样才能让它工作?我正在使用VSCode1.6.1和DonJayamanne的Python扩展运行Kubuntu16.04。啊,是的,我希望我在这个问题上处于正确的位置,并且不违反任何规则。更新:刚刚尝试了EltonStoneman的方法。有了它,我收到了这个错误:There
我刚刚注册了这个问题。这是关于是否可以使用VSCode在Docker容器中远程调试python代码。我在这里有一个完全配置的Docker容器。我得到了一些帮助,而且我对docker还是很陌生。在其中运行Odoov10。但是我无法在VSCode中进行远程调试。我试过this解释,但我真的不明白。甚至可能吗?如果是,我怎样才能让它工作?我正在使用VSCode1.6.1和DonJayamanne的Python扩展运行Kubuntu16.04。啊,是的,我希望我在这个问题上处于正确的位置,并且不违反任何规则。更新:刚刚尝试了EltonStoneman的方法。有了它,我收到了这个错误:There
在我的初始化程序之一中,我需要从Redis实例中获取一些哈希值。然而,由于哈希的数量和连接的弱点,加载可能需要很长时间。由于它在初始化程序中,因此在所有哈希值都已加载之前应用程序不可用。因此我想我可以在一个线程中执行初始化,这样应用程序就可以启动,然后哈希将按时加载,因为它们对应用程序来说不是必需的。我试过这样的:REDIS=Redis.new(:host=>uri.host,:port=>uri.port,:password=>uri.password)STORE={}Thread.abort_on_exception=trueThread.newdoREDIS.keys.eachd
创建docker服务时,我遇到以下错误。错误响应来自守护程序:rpc错误:代码=2desc=名称与现有对象冲突步骤docker-machinecreate--drivervirtualboxswarm-1docker-machinecreate--drivervirtualboxswarm-2docker-machinecreate--drivervirtualboxswarm-3eval$(docker-machineenvswarm-1)dockerswarminit--advertise-addr$(docker-machineipswarm-1)docker-machiness
我们正在尝试将DHH的简单Rails5聊天示例部署到AWS上的单个自包含EC2实例。代码可在此处获得:https://github.com/HectorPerez/chat-in-rails5我们使用ElasticBeanstalk来启动单个实例:ebcreatedev-env-p“64bitAmazonLinux2015.09v2.0.4runningRuby2.2(Puma)”–single-it2.micro--envvarsSECRET_KEY_BASE=g5dh9cg614a37d4bdece9126b42d50d0ab8b2fc785daa1e0dac0383d6387f3
我正在尝试通过以下方式设置NSMutableParagraphStyle:@IBOutletweakvarheadline:UILabel!{didSet{letstyle=NSMutableParagraphStyle()style.maximumLineHeight=15style.lineSpacing=0style.alignment=.centerletattributes:[NSAttributedStringKey:Any]=[NSAttributedStringKey.paragraphStyle:style,NSAttributedStringKey.baseline